01 · Runtime ladder

Capacity steps, on the same load

Nominal capacity × depth of discharge × inverter efficiency ÷ sourced average draw.

Estimated runtime by portable power station capacity
Capacity classEstimated runtimeEvidence
300 Whstep 10.1 hrInduction cooktop (1,800W element) load · 2026-07-20
500 Whstep 20.2 hrInduction cooktop (1,800W element) load · 2026-07-20
1,000 Whstep 30.4 hrInduction cooktop (1,800W element) load · 2026-07-20
2,000 Whstep 40.9 hrInduction cooktop (1,800W element) load · 2026-07-20

These are comparison projections, not a promise. Temperature, inverter behavior, cycling, and the individual station's measured delivered capacity can change real runtime.

Questions, answered from the same inputs

Can a portable power station run induction cooktop?
Yes. 13 stations in the current sourced catalog pass the capacity and inverter checks for the default runtime.
What power figure matters most for induction cooktop?
The sourced running draw determines both inverter fit and battery runtime. No separate real-watt startup figure is available from the cited source.
How are the runtime estimates calculated?
BatteryRank multiplies rated capacity by the published depth-of-discharge and inverter-efficiency assumptions, then divides by the sourced average device draw.
